nose

all through the season we have thrown points away, under jol, under rene, yesterday.
we have enough talented players to be doing much better BUT we do not have a proper forward line.
IMO, no matter what other shortcomings we have the inability to send the ball forward and have a player to get on the end of it and hold it up has been a disaster.... when bobby Z left we did not replace him with anyone. berba was a great player, no question one of the most gifted I have seem but not what we needed.

You need a player up top that can play with his back to goal and hold up the [lay and bobby was a master at that game, we just do nit have such a player and other than a few world class teams every team needs a player of that type. we lose possesion far to easilly going forward and bent doesn't do that, hugo can't and mitroglu is an unknown commodity. I think that is one of the issues why we concede so may late goals, the ball is whacked up the field, but comes straight back, what we need is a man that can get it and hold it and bring the midfield into play, frustrate the opposition and waste some time, and even pinch the odd sucker punch goal.

Jol was neglectful of this because of berba, rene never got such a player and now felix has to figure out a way to deal with it and i don't think it is going to be that easy.

yesterday brought into focus the problem of not having such a  player
